Taylor Woodrow expects half-year results to be healthy


Taylor Woodrow is expected to report gains across its housing and construction arms, according to the group’s latest trading statement for the first six months of 2004.

 

Prior to the release of its half-year results on 3 August, Taywood revealed that its construction order book now stands at £825m compared to £749m in the same period last year.

 

Operating margins for the group’s housing division across the UK and North America will be comfortably ahead of the proforma 14% achieved during the first half of 2003.

 

The group's UK housing division sold 3,869 homes compared to 2,336 in the same period last year.

The average selling price of Taywood’s UK houses is now £199,100 compared to £187,100 in the first six months of 2003.
